\nThe mouse study showed that the composition of the naturally occurring bacterial population that lives in the gut, known as the gut microbiome, changes with age — favoring some species of bacteria over others. These changes are registered by immune cells in the gastrointestinal tract, which spark an inflammatory response that hampers the ability of the vagus nerve to signal to the hippocampus — the part of the brain responsible for memory formation and spatial navigation. Stimulating the activity of the vagus nerve in older animals turned old, forgetful mice into whisker-sharp whizzes able to remember novel objects and escape from mazes as nimbly as their younger counterparts.
